The leader of the gang of armed robbers who attacked popular Hiplife artiste Mzbel at her Gbawe residence last year has been arrested.
The suspect, Kojo Aboagye alias Joe, 26, who was declared wanted by the police after the incident was arrested at his hideout at Korle Gonno on Friday following a tip off.
Joe admitted the offence during interrogation and said he committed the crime with the three who were earlier arrested but broke jail.
According to the Accra Regional Crime Officer, Chief Superintendent Boi-Bi-Boi, on September 12, 2006, the four suspects Munkaila Tahiru, Kennedy Agbozo, Emmanuel Agozie and Kojo Aboagye attacked Mzbel and one of her dancers, Bernice Botchwey at the artiste’s house at New Gbawe.
He said the robbers, wielding pistols, knives and clubs made away with her laptop, digital cameras, two DVD players, both local and foreign currencies and other valuables.
He said the robbers sexually assaulted Mzbel and one of her dancers who were with her in the house at the time of the incident.
Mr Boi-Bi-Boi said on October 27, 2006 Mzbel identified three of her attackers at the La Pleasure Beach and raised an alarm which led to their arrest.
The Crime Officer said the robbers were detained the Odorkor Police cells for further investigations but the three threw pepper into the eyes of the policeman on duty and managed to escape.
He said the police had mounted an intensive search for the arrest of the suspects who were believed to be hiding in the country.
Mr Boi-Bi-Boi therefore appealed to any member of the public with information which would lead to the arrest of the jail breakers to report at the Regional Police Command or the nearest police station and assist in investigations.
